# Fixturekit env — eng sync copy
# Covers the Dovebridge test-data factory library.
# Profile must stay "sync-demo" so generated records match the slides.
# Do not bump the seed mid-week; charts will drift.
# FIXTUREKIT_PROFILE=sync-demo below, then the factory's
# upstream auth secret goes on the line immediately after this comment block.

sealed setting: ARCHIVE_KEY3=8d0

Minutes — Management Meeting, Divestiture of the Coastal Logistics Unit. Attendees: M. Varenholt, P. Dussane, L. Okiri. The committee reviewed two indicative offers for the unit, noting the stronger bid from Teliqua Group includes a working-capital adjustment that finance must model carefully. P. Dussane flagged pension transfer costs as unresolved. Legal will circulate a revised data-room index by Friday. The agreed negotiating position is summarised below.

board note of baguf-fafog: Kasixox Foods plans to lower the Drueth list price by 48 percent in March.

## Changelog — Breakerbox 3.2

Heads up: we changed the circuit breaker defaults for the Quillfeed upstream API. The old thresholds tripped way too eagerly during routine latency blips, so we loosened the failure window and added a half-open probe interval. If your service pinned the old values, nothing changes for you. Everyone else inherits the new defaults, listed below for review.

deployment values, yahag-tawef:
ZORWYN_HOST=zorwyn.tolvaqlabs.internal
ZORWYN_PORT=9300

Runbook: PickPath Optimizer (Harlen Fulfillment). If pick-list batches stall past five minutes, restart the optimizer worker before touching the queue. Verify the Redwick depot feed is current, then confirm the solver license check passes in staging. Once the worker restarts cleanly, add the solver credential as the next line of the env file.

sealed setting: VAULT_KEY20=dd440a383707adecf165

## Artifact Signing for Switchyard Bundles

Every Switchyard feature-flag bundle is signed at build time, and edge relays refuse unsigned payloads. New team members should verify any bundle they handle manually before uploading. Verification uses the team's published key, reproduced below.

signing key of bagap-yawep = bky13_TbfT6ZMUoGJo2